Struct snarkvm_polycommit::kzg10::Proof
source · [−]pub struct Proof<E: PairingEngine> {
pub w: E::G1Affine,
pub random_v: Option<E::Fr>,
}
Expand description
Proof
is an evaluation proof that is output by KZG10::open
.
Fields
w: E::G1Affine
This is a commitment to the witness polynomial; see [KZG10] for more details.
random_v: Option<E::Fr>
This is the evaluation of the random polynomial at the point for which the evaluation proof was produced.
